With only a few departures on weekdays, route 4546 connects Biscainho to the ITS terminal in Setúbal, passing through Gâmbia, Algeruz, Pontes and Alto da Guerra—a journey that combines rural areas, dining hubs and urban facilities.

The route begins in Biscainho and continues through Gâmbia, where the landscape is marked by scattered homes, small commercial activities and local roads. It then reaches the EN 10 and passes through Algeruz, Vale da Abrunheira, Pontes and Cotovia, following one of the main road connections between Palmela and Setúbal.

As it approaches the city, the setting becomes more urban. The route crosses Alto da Guerra and Poço Mouro, passes through the commercial area of Avenida Álvaro Cunhal and enters Setúbal via Avenida do Alentejo, Avenida Pedro Álvares Cabral and Avenida João II, ending at the ITS terminal, near the Praça de Touros area.

Attention: the distances shown are approximate and estimated from the coordinates provided for the route, the locations of the stops and the addresses consulted. The route operates only on weekdays, with two departures in the Biscainho–Setúbal direction and three departures in the Setúbal–Biscainho direction. Praça de Touros Carlos Relvas

Practically on the section leading to the ITS terminal, Praça de Touros Carlos Relvas is one of Setúbal’s most recognizable architectural landmarks. Inaugurated in 1889, the building has an octagonal plan and decorative elements associated with the Neo-Moorish style, such as horseshoe arches and brick details.

Today, the venue is also used for events and cultural initiatives, including presentations connected with the Marchas Populares de Setúbal. The stop identified in the itinerary as Avenida Dom João II, next to Praça de Touros, leaves visitors just a few minutes’ walk from the building.

Jardim do Bonfim

For those arriving at ITS and wanting to extend their outing, Jardim do Bonfim offers a green break in a central area of Setúbal. Covering more than 42,000 square meters, it is the oldest formal green space in the municipality, originating in the 16th century.

The garden includes a lake, notable trees and recreation areas, as well as a playground, dining facilities, restrooms and an amphitheater. Among the features worth seeing are the Pasmadinhos de Setúbal, sculptures honoring important figures in local identity, such as Bocage and Luísa Todi.

Estádio do Bonfim

Estádio do Bonfim, the historic home of Vitória Futebol Clube, is a short walk from the final section of the route. In addition to matches, the complex is used for sports activities and events connected with football and other sports.

The visit is especially appealing to fans and anyone interested in Setúbal’s sporting history. Since the stadium is in the urban area near ITS and Praça de Touros, it can be combined with a walk through Jardim do Bonfim or a stop at the city’s shops.
